Background technology
Polypropylene( PP)It is a kind of thermoplastic synthetic resin of function admirable, is one of five big general synthetic resins.Poly- third Alkene has the advantages that small, nontoxic density, easy processing, excellent in cushion effect, flex stiffiness and electrical insulating property are good, can using injection, A variety of manufacturing process such as extrusion molding, blown film, coating, spinneret, modification are processed into various industrial and civilian plastic products, are widely used in The fields such as electronic apparatus, automobile, building materials, medical treatment, packaging.
With conventional plastic bottle material polyethylene terephthalate(PET)Compare, PP materials have following feature: (1) it is general to need, by special thermal finalization processing, no more than 93 DEG C of hot filling be born through the PET hot-filling bottles prepared Temperature, does not reach the hot filling requirement of tea beverage.PP by comparison, can bear 100 DEG C of filling temperature, become hot-filling Process Obtain easy.(2) PP density is light compared with PET, and the bottle PP for manufacturing same volume saves raw material than PET;PP equipment is thrown Money is few, and PET is the resin of the easily moisture absorption, before processing special equipment must be used to be dried;(3) PET recovery is compared Trouble, the resistance to aggressive washes agent is weaker, can not be subjected to high-temperature sterilization, and PP materials then can be reclaimed all.By This is visible, and the most potential market of PP beverage bottles is in heat filling beverage.Occupy very big ratio due to being packaged in beverage cost Weight, therefore, even if using the enterprise of PET hot-filling bottles, it is also possible to therefore turn to.
Generally prepared in PP plastics and must be added to a certain amount of antioxidant in process, to ensure material Durability.The most frequently used antioxidant is hindered phenol anti-oxidants in PP plastics, and representative is 2,6- di-t-butyls Paracresol and four (3,5- di-t-butyl -4- hydroxyls) benzenpropanoic acid pentaerythritol esters.Research shows that Excess free enthalpy antioxidant may Harm is healthy.Therefore, developing the preparation technology of the PP plastics of non-toxic oxidant has important effect.
The content of the invention
For the production method of the PP plastic bottles of developing non-toxic oxidant, the invention provides a kind of PP plastics of improvement Bottle and its production technology, described production technology comprise the following steps:
(1)After dibenzoyl peroxide tetrahydrofuran is dissolved, add a certain amount of acrylic acid lanthanum be made after mixed solution with Added after PP GRANULES is well mixed in plasticator and carry out graft copolymerization, modified polypropylene thing is obtained after plasticating uniformly Material;
(2)To weigh in proportion after modified polypropylene material, silica, antiseptic, antioxidant, high-speed stirred by its It is well mixed to obtain mixture;
(3)Obtained mixture is added to blending and modifying in extruder and obtains modified PP GRANULES;
(4)Modified PP GRANULES is sent into note after modeling white silk under the conditions of 140-200 DEG C to blow in all-in-one, by barrel temperature It is set to after 150-200 DEG C, sample point is injected for four sections, four sections of speed is respectively 75-65,35-40,30-20,20- 15, four sections pressure difference 50-80,35-45,25-20,15-20 after hybrid particles processing, after being cooled down at the beginning of injecting preform, blow The PP plastic bottles improved are stripped after modeling sizing.
Further, step(1)Described in content of the dibenzoyl peroxide in tetrahydrofuran be 0.02-0.05%;Institute The content of acrylic acid lanthanum in the solution is stated for 0.2-0.5%.
Further, step(1)Described in temperature when plasticating be 150-200 DEG C, the described time of plasticating is 10-15 points Clock.
Further, step(1)Described in antiseptic be shrubby sophora extract, forsythia suspense extraction, Chinese rhubarb extract in It is one or more;Described antioxidant is in gallic acid, anthocyanidin, green tea polyphenols extract and pawpaw polyphenol extract One or more.
Further, described step(2)Polypropylene material, silica after neutrality, antiseptic, antioxidant each group The percentage composition divided is respectively 80-85%, 12-8%, 2-4%, 2-4%.
Further, step(3)Described in extruder blending when temperature be 140-155 DEG C, the blending time be 2-3 Hour.
Further, step(4)Described in improvement after PP bottles can be used for tea beverage, fruit drink, milk and medicine In product.
PP bottles after the improvement of the present invention, as prepared by above-mentioned preparation method.
The features of the present invention is:Plastic bottle preparing raw material, compared with traditional PET raw materials, the PP of preparation are used as by the use of PP Bottle has more preferable heat resistance and corrosion resistance;The present invention is modified using acrylic acid lanthanum to polypropylene, in PP materials Introduce the anti-impact force that rare earth high polymer adds material;The present invention uses and uses natural antibacterial, antioxidant content simultaneously, it is impossible to The shelf-life of the food of packaging is effectively ensured, while reducing the toxicity of plastic bottle, the security of product is improved.Through the present invention Obtained PP bottles can not only be applied to soymilk, fruit juice, the packaging of the liquid food such as tea, while also can be suitably used for the bag of liquid drug Dress.
